Question 403: To ask the Minister for Communications, Marine and Natural Resources if the granting of a compulsory purchase order to Shell in regard to the route of the proposed Corrib pipeline is unique; and the legal basis on which it was granted. [10355/05]
Noel Dempsey (Meath,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context
Section 32(1)(a) of the Gas Act 1976 as amended provides that "any person may apply to the Minister for an order under this section to acquire compulsorily any land or right over land which is required by that person for or in connection with the performance of any function of that person." In accordance with this section, compulsory acquisition orders were issued to the developers.
